Wood Window Service in Franklin, TN
Wood window services encompass a range of projects focused on the repair, restoration, and maintenance of wooden window frames and sashes. Homeowners often seek these services to improve the appearance of their windows, enhance energy efficiency, or restore the original charm of older properties. Common projects include replacing rotted or damaged wood, refinishing or repainting surfaces, and upgrading hardware for better functionality.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of work involved, the materials used, and the potential impact on their home's aesthetics and energy performance before requesting services.
Before requesting wood window services, property owners should consider the age and condition of their windows, as well as their goals for renovation or repair. Knowing whether the project involves full replacement or restoration can influence the approach and cost. It’s also helpful to understand the differences between wood and other window materials, and to identify any specific issues such as drafts, warped frames, or broken hardware. This information can assist in selecting the most appropriate services to maintain the character and value of the property.

Common Wood Window Service Jobs
Wood window repair - restoring damaged or rotted wood components for improved function and appearance.
Wood window replacement - installing new wood windows to enhance energy efficiency and curb appeal.
Wood window restoration - stripping, refinishing, and sealing existing wood windows to extend their lifespan.
Custom wood window fabrication - creating tailored window designs to match historic or unique property styles.
Wood window reglazing - replacing broken or deteriorated glass panes to improve safety and insulation.
Wood window maintenance - cleaning, sealing, and protecting wood surfaces to prevent decay and weather damage.
